Subtract 56/3 from 27/90
1st number: 27/90, 2nd number: 18 2/3
27/90 - 56/3 is -551/30.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 90 and 3 is 90
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 90 - For the 1st fraction, since 90 × 1 = 90,
27/90 = 27 × 1/90 × 1 = 27/90 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 3 × 30 = 90,
56/3 = 56 × 30/3 × 30 = 1680/90 - Subtract the two like fractions:
27/90 - 1680/90 = 27 - 1680/90 = -1653/90 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is -551/30
